What is graphql-playground-html?

The graphql-playground-html npm package provides a way to embed GraphQL Playground, a powerful GraphQL IDE, into your web applications. It allows developers to interact with their GraphQL APIs through a user-friendly interface, making it easier to test queries, mutations, and subscriptions.

What are graphql-playground-html's main functionalities?

Embedding GraphQL Playground

This code sample demonstrates how to embed GraphQL Playground into an HTML page. It includes the necessary CSS and JavaScript files from a CDN and initializes the playground with a specified GraphQL endpoint.

<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
  <head>
    <meta charset="utf-8" />
    <title>GraphQL Playground</title>
    <link rel="stylesheet" href="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/graphql-playground-html@latest/build/static/css/index.css" />
    <link rel="shortcut icon" href="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/graphql-playground-html@latest/build/favicon.png" />
    <script src="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/graphql-playground-html@latest/build/static/js/middleware.js"></script>
  </head>
  <body>
    <div id="root"></div>
    <script>
      window.addEventListener('load', function (event) {
        GraphQLPlayground.init(document.getElementById('root'), { endpoint: '/graphql' })
      })
    </script>
  </body>
</html>

Customizing GraphQL Playground

This code sample shows how to customize the GraphQL Playground by setting various options such as the editor theme and cursor shape. These settings can be adjusted to fit the developer's preferences.

<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
  <head>
    <meta charset="utf-8" />
    <title>GraphQL Playground</title>
    <link rel="stylesheet" href="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/graphql-playground-html@latest/build/static/css/index.css" />
    <link rel="shortcut icon" href="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/graphql-playground-html@latest/build/favicon.png" />
    <script src="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/graphql-playground-html@latest/build/static/js/middleware.js"></script>
  </head>
  <body>
    <div id="root"></div>
    <script>
      window.addEventListener('load', function (event) {
        GraphQLPlayground.init(document.getElementById('root'), {
          endpoint: '/graphql',
          settings: {
            'editor.theme': 'dark',
            'editor.cursorShape': 'line'
          }
        })
      })
    </script>
  </body>
</html>
